Product Definition
Mild steel plates are defined within the report as a category of carbon steel that is characterized by a low amount of carbon, making it more ductile, malleable, and easy to weld compared to high carbon steels. Commonly used in construction machinery, automotive frames, and building structures, mild steel plates are fundamental to various industrial applications due to their strength and formability.
